设备管理系统网页源代码

首页 / 常见问题 / 设备管理系统 / 设备管理系统网页源代码
作者:设备厂商 发布时间:08-20 15:58 浏览量:5072
logo
织信企业级低代码开发平台
提供表单、流程、仪表盘、API等功能,非IT用户可通过设计表单来收集数据,设计流程来进行业务协作,使用仪表盘来进行数据分析与展示,IT用户可通过API集成第三方系统平台数据。
免费试用

设备管理系统网页源代码可以通过使用HTML、CSS、JavaScript和后端语言如PHP或Python等实现,关键是要确保系统的功能完整、用户体验良好、安全性高。其中,设备信息管理、用户权限控制、数据安全是需要重点关注的内容。下面我将详细介绍设备信息管理的实现,它涉及设备的添加、修改、删除和查看。设备管理系统的核心在于对设备的有效管理,通过友好的界面和强大的功能,用户可以方便地管理设备信息,提高工作效率。

一、设备信息管理

设备信息管理是设备管理系统的核心功能之一。这个模块主要实现对设备信息的增删改查操作。添加设备功能允许管理员将新设备信息录入系统,包含设备名称、型号、序列号、购买日期、保修期等信息。实现这个功能需要前端表单提交数据,后端进行数据处理并存储在数据库中。修改设备信息功能允许管理员更新设备的相关信息,确保设备数据的准确性。删除设备功能则用于移除不再使用或报废的设备。查看设备功能则提供设备信息的展示和搜索功能,方便用户快速查找设备信息。

HTML代码示例:

<!DOCTYPE html>

<html>

<head>

<title>设备管理系统</title>

<link rel="stylesheet" type="text/css" href="styles.css">

</head>

<body>

<h1>设备管理系统</h1>

<form action="add_device.php" method="post">

<label for="deviceName">设备名称:</label>

<input type="text" id="deviceName" name="deviceName" required><br>

<label for="model">型号:</label>

<input type="text" id="model" name="model" required><br>

<label for="serialNumber">序列号:</label>

<input type="text" id="serialNumber" name="serialNumber" required><br>

<label for="purchaseDate">购买日期:</label>

<input type="date" id="purchaseDate" name="purchaseDate" required><br>

<label for="warrantyPeriod">保修期:</label>

<input type="text" id="warrantyPeriod" name="warrantyPeriod" required><br>

<input type="submit" value="添加设备">

</form>

</body>

</html>

二、用户权限控制

用户权限控制是设备管理系统中确保数据安全和操作规范的重要功能。通过设置不同的用户角色,如管理员、普通用户等,可以实现对系统操作权限的有效管理。管理员具备所有权限,可以添加、修改、删除设备信息以及管理用户。普通用户则只能查看设备信息。实现用户权限控制需要在系统中添加用户管理模块,前端提供用户登录和注册功能,后端进行权限验证和控制。

示例PHP代码:

<?php

session_start();

if (!isset($_SESSION['user_role']) || $_SESSION['user_role'] != 'admin') {

header("Location: login.php");

exit();

}

?>

三、数据安全

数据安全是设备管理系统的关键保障。为了防止数据泄露和篡改,需要采用多种安全措施。首先,使用HTTPS协议加密数据传输,确保数据在传输过程中不被窃取。其次,对用户输入的数据进行验证和过滤,防止SQL注入和跨站脚本攻击。再次,定期备份数据库数据,防止数据丢失。最后,设置强密码策略,要求用户使用复杂密码,并定期更换。

四、系统界面设计

系统界面设计直接影响用户体验。一个良好的界面设计应具备简洁、美观、易操作的特点。导航栏、表单、按钮等元素需要布局合理,操作流程清晰。通过响应式设计,实现不同设备上的良好显示效果。使用现代前端框架如Bootstrap,可以大大提高界面开发效率。

CSS代码示例:

body {

font-family: Arial, sans-serif;

margin: 0;

padding: 0;

background-color: #f4f4f4;

}

h1 {

background-color: #333;

color: #fff;

padding: 10px 0;

text-align: center;

}

form {

margin: 20px auto;

width: 300px;

padding: 20px;

background-color: #fff;

border: 1px solid #ccc;

border-radius: 5px;

}

label {

display: block;

margin-bottom: 5px;

}

input[type="text"], input[type="date"] {

width: 100%;

padding: 8px;

margin-bottom: 10px;

border: 1px solid #ccc;

border-radius: 3px;

}

input[type="submit"] {

background-color: #333;

color: #fff;

padding: 10px;

border: none;

border-radius: 3px;

cursor: pointer;

}

input[type="submit"]:hover {

background-color: #555;

}

五、数据报表与分析

设备管理系统还应具备数据报表与分析功能,通过统计和分析设备数据,为管理决策提供支持。可以生成设备使用情况报表、故障率统计报表、成本分析报表等。数据报表可以采用图表和表格的形式展示,直观明了。通过对数据的深入分析,可以发现设备管理中的问题和改进点,提升设备管理的效率和效果。

六、系统维护与升级

系统维护与升级是设备管理系统长久运行的保障。定期进行系统检查,及时修复发现的漏洞和问题。根据用户反馈和技术发展,不断优化和升级系统功能,满足用户需求。保持系统的可扩展性,为未来的功能扩展和升级留出空间。通过良好的维护和升级,确保系统的稳定性和安全性。

七、用户培训与支持

为了确保用户能够熟练使用设备管理系统,需要提供全面的用户培训和支持。可以通过在线教程、操作手册、视频演示等形式进行培训。建立用户支持中心,提供及时的技术支持和问题解答。通过良好的培训与支持,提高用户的使用满意度和系统的应用效果。

八、集成与扩展

设备管理系统应具备良好的集成与扩展能力。可以与企业的其他管理系统如ERP、CRM等进行集成,实现数据的共享和流程的自动化。通过开放API接口,支持第三方应用的接入和扩展。不断扩展系统功能,提升系统的应用价值和竞争力。

九、案例分析

通过一些实际案例,可以更直观地了解设备管理系统的应用效果。例如,一家制造企业通过设备管理系统,实现了设备的精细化管理,设备故障率降低了30%,设备利用率提高了20%。另一家服务企业通过设备管理系统,优化了设备维护流程,维护成本降低了25%。这些案例展示了设备管理系统在不同领域的广泛应用和显著效果。

总结以上内容,通过全面的设备信息管理、用户权限控制、数据安全、系统界面设计、数据报表与分析、系统维护与升级、用户培训与支持、集成与扩展以及案例分析,可以构建一个功能强大、用户体验良好、安全可靠的设备管理系统,助力企业实现高效的设备管理。

相关问答FAQs:

设备管理系统网页源代码是什么?

设备管理系统网页源代码是指用于构建和维护设备管理系统的HTML、CSS和JavaScript代码。这些代码可以帮助用户跟踪、管理和维护各种设备的状态、位置和使用情况。设备管理系统通常被用于企业、学校和其他组织,以便更有效地管理资产。源代码包括前端界面设计和后端逻辑处理,确保用户能够通过网页与系统进行交互。通常,这些代码会涉及数据库连接,以便存储和检索设备的信息,并提供实时更新。

如何构建一个设备管理系统网页?

构建一个设备管理系统网页涉及多个步骤。首先,需要明确系统的需求,包括用户角色、功能模块和界面设计。接着,选择适合的技术栈,如HTML、CSS和JavaScript用于前端开发,而Node.js、Python或Java可以用于后端开发。数据库方面,MySQL或MongoDB都是常见的选择。根据需求设计数据库结构,并编写相应的API接口,确保前后端能够有效沟通。最后,进行测试和优化,确保系统的稳定性和用户体验。构建过程中,使用版本控制工具如Git来管理代码变更也是非常重要的。

设备管理系统网页源代码的常见功能有哪些?

设备管理系统网页源代码通常包含多个功能,以满足不同用户的需求。首先,设备登记功能允许用户添加新设备的信息,包括设备名称、型号、序列号等。其次,设备状态监控功能可以实时显示设备的运行状态,比如在线、离线或故障。搜索和过滤功能使用户能够快速找到特定设备。数据报表生成功能则帮助用户分析设备使用情况,生成周报或月报。此外,权限管理功能确保不同角色的用户能够访问相应的数据和功能,从而提高系统的安全性和可靠性。这些功能的实现,依赖于前端展示和后端逻辑的良好结合。

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系邮箱:hopper@cornerstone365.cn 处理,核实后本网站将在24小时内删除。

最近更新

如何使用python写华三设备的自动化巡检脚本
10-24 16:55
如何进行IoT设备管理?
10-24 16:55
非标自动化设备哪家比较好
10-24 16:55
私有部署如何支持移动设备访问
10-24 16:55
移动设备(手机)的少数ID有哪些
10-24 16:55
管理大规模设备的自动化技术
10-24 16:55
为什么没有可以自适应设备尺寸大小的 PDF 阅读器
10-24 16:55
开发了一套安防平台软件,如何寻找设备商或渠道商合作
10-24 16:55
如何在服务器上部署IoT设备
10-24 16:55

立即开启你的数字化管理

用心为每一位用户提供专业的数字化解决方案及业务咨询

  • 深圳市基石协作科技有限公司
  • 地址:深圳市南山区科技中一路大族激光科技中心909室
  • 座机:400-185-5850
  • 手机:137-1379-6908
  • 邮箱:sales@cornerstone365.cn
  • 微信公众号二维码

© copyright 2019-2024. 织信INFORMAT 深圳市基石协作科技有限公司 版权所有 | 粤ICP备15078182号

前往Gitee仓库
微信公众号二维码
咨询织信数字化顾问获取最新资料
数字化咨询热线
400-185-5850
申请预约演示
立即与行业专家交流